3bmm57zi.life

Website Ranking Data
Current Alexa Rank

30,591

Updated Jul 17 2022
Historical Rank
Estimated Visitors

101,886

Daily Unique Visitors

3,158,462

Monthly Visitors

37,901,544

Yearly Visitors
Top related sites: